Ingredients
- ROLLS
- 1 1/4 ounces active dry yeast
- 1 cup milk, scalded
- 1/2 cup sugar
- 1/3 cup margarine, melted
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 2 - eggs
- 4 cups all purpose flour
- FILLING
- 1 cup brown sugar
- 1 tablespoon cinnamon
- 1/3 cup margarine, softened
- ICING
- 1 stick margarine, softened
- 1/2 cup powdered sugar
- 1/4 cup cream cheese, room temperature (2 oz)
- 1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1/8 teaspoon salt
How To Make cinnabon cinnamon rolls
-
Step 1Preheat oven to 400 degrees F.
-
Step 2For the rolls, dissolve the yeast in the warm milk in a large bowl.
-
Step 3Add the sugar, margarine, salt, eggs, and flour, and mix well.
-
Step 4Knead the dough into a large ball, using your hands dusted lightly with flour. Put in a bowl, cover, and let rise in a warm place abut 1 hour or until doubled in size.
-
Step 5Roll the dough out on a lightly floured surface. Roll the dough flat until it is about 21 in. long and 16 in. wide (about 1/4" thick).
-
Step 6For the filling, combine the brown sugar and cinnamon in a bowl. Spread the softened margarine evenly over the surface of the dough, and then sprinkle the cinnamon and sugar evenly over the surface.
-
Step 7Working carefully from the 21" side, roll the dough.
-
Step 8Cut the rolled dough into 1-3/4" slices and place 6 at a time, evenly spaced, in a lightly greased baking pan. Bake for 10 min. or until light brown on top.
-
Step 9While the rolls bake, combine the icing ingredients. Beat well with an electric mixer until fluffy.
-
Step 10When the rolls come out of the oven, coat each generously with icing.
